borrBorealin-related (borr) encodes one of the three targeting subunits for the product of aurB in the chromosomal passenger complex. It helps to target the complex to the centromere region of chromosomes and the cleavage furrow during cytokinesis. At centromeres the complex is involved both in pausing mitotic progression when there are chromosome mis-attachments and in correcting those mis-attachments. At the cleavage furrow, the complex is involved in regulating the process of abscission (cell separation). (319 aa)
aurBAurora B (aurB) encodes a serine-threonine kinase and member of the chromosomal passenger complex. It plays multiple roles in mitosis including the correction of erroneous chromosome-spindle interactions, chromosome condensation, kinetochore assembly, spindle assembly checkpoint and cytokinesis. dgt2Augmin complex subunit dgt2; As part of the augmin complex, plays a role in centrosome- independent generation of spindle microtubules. The complex is required for mitotic spindle assembly through its involvement in localizing gamma-tubulin to spindle microtubules. dgt2 binds to microtubules in vitro. (231 aa)
IncenpInner centromere protein (Incenp) encodes a component of the chromosomal passenger complex, acting as a subunit that targets and activates the product of aurB. It controls different processes during cell division, including regulation of chromosome structure, kinetochore-microtubule error correction, chromosome segregation and cytokinesis. (755 aa)

gammaTub37CTubulin gamma-2 chain; Tubulin is the major constituent of microtubules. The gamma chain is found at microtubule organizing centers (MTOC) such as the spindle poles or the centrosome, suggesting that it is involved in the minus-end nucleation of microtubule assembly. Required for oocyte activation and consequently for organization of the female meiotic spindle. Essential for centrosome organization and assembly of biastral mitotic spindles in embryos. Plays a role in stabilizing the augmin complex on the meiotic spindle. (457 aa)
austAustralin, isoform A; Australin (aust) is a male meiotic specific paralogue of borr, which encodes one of the three targeting subunits for the product of aurB in the chromosomal passenger complex (CPC). The CPC is critical in regulating multiple aspects of cell division, including chromosome condensation, kinetochore function and cytokinesis, through the kinase activity of the product of aurB. ncdProtein claret segregational; Non-claret disjunctional (ncd) encodes a minus-end-directed kinesin microtubule motor protein and the sole member of the kinesin-14 motor family. It is required for spindle assembly in oocytes and chromosome attachment to spindles in early embryos; Belongs to the TRAFAC class myosin-kinesin ATPase superfamily. Kinesin family. NCD subfamily. ssp2Short spindle 2 (ssp2) encodes a microtubule plus-end-tracking protein that binds to the product of Eb1 and the microtubule polymerase encoded by msps. It contributes to dynamic microtubule behaviour, spindle size and kinetochore-microtubule interaction. (982 aa)
